- Judith Durham's biography is named after this song, which she wrote with her friend David Reilly. The video is from 'The World of The Seekers' TV special (1968 - now available on a DVD with 2 other specials, including this song & 47 others! - www.theseekers.com.au/merchand.... I've used the original audio (from 1967), to enhance the clip so that it plays at the correct speed / pitch and in stereo. More videos from Judith and The Seekers on the playlists below:
